Предмет: Информатика, автор: cehunvika6

ПАЙТОН! Напишіть Програму Створити калькулятор. Користувач вводить з клавіатури арифметичний вираз в рядок. Наприклад, 23+12. Виведіть результат виразу на екран. У нашому прикладі 35. Арифметичний вираз може складатися тільки з трьох частин: число, операція, число. Можливі операції: +, -, *, /. (Повинно окремо створити калькулятор не в рядок а запитувати по черзі число операцію і число2) ​

Ответы

Автор ответа: devpaul
0

Ответ:

Python:

def calculate():

   # Запитує перше число від користувача та перетворює його на число з плаваючою точкою

   num1 = float(input("Введіть перше число: "))

   

   # Запит на операцію від користувача

   operation = input("Введіть операцію (+, -, *, /): ")

   

   # Запитує друге число від користувача та перетворює його на число з плаваючою точкою

   num2 = float(input("Введіть друге число: "))

   # Перевіряє операцію, яку запитав користувач, і виконує відповідну операцію

   if operation == '+':

       result = num1 + num2

   elif operation == '-':

       result = num1 - num2

   elif operation == '*':

       result = num1 * num2

   elif operation == '/':

       result = num1 / num2

   else:

       # Якщо введено неправильний оператор, надрукує повідомлення про помилку

       print("Недійсний оператор")

       return

   # Відображення результату операції

   print("Результат:", result)

# Викликає функцію для виконання розрахунку

calculate()

Похожие вопросы